Lexus TZ Makes Its World Debut at the Japanese Test Track Where Roads Literally Build Cars
SHERIDAN, WYOMING -- June 1, 2026 -- Lexus has just pulled back the curtain on its brand-new model, the TZ, in one of the most unusual and meaningful settings a car company could choose: a working development facility deep in Aichi Prefecture, Japan, where engineers, designers, and drivers spend their days pushing cars to the breaking point and then fixing them on the spot. The world premiere took place on May 7, 2026, at the Toyota Technical Center Shimoyama (TTC-S), a sprawling test and development hub spanning Toyota City and Okazaki City -- a place that is normally closed to the outside world, which makes its choice as a debut venue all the more significant for Lexus fans and car enthusiasts alike.
